Object Avoidance
Object avoidance features allow your robot to avoid running into things such as power cords, toys and clothes that get caught up in the vacuum. These are particularly important if you have children or pets who are prone to leaving objects on the floor where your robot will discover them.
Based on the model you choose, you might have an array of different sensor options available to help your robot navigate around obstacles. Some of the most sought-after include crossed IR sensor beams, which are infrared-focused lights that scan the room to look for furniture legs or door frames. Many robots have embraced this technology, and you can find it in the flagship models that are more expensive.
Other object avoidance technologies that can be found in more expensive robots include 3D Structured Light, which uses cameras and crossed IR sensors to map the surrounding area and identify obstacles; and Time of Flight (ToF) sensors which emit and measure the time it takes for light to reflect off objects, to determine the distance between them. These are less common but are a great option for your robot should you want to have more security.

Maintenance
A robot vacuum can help you keep up with your home. The top models can collect more surface dirt, pet hair and lint, than the broom that is used on low-pile or hard floors. They have navigational features that prevent them from getting stuck on power cords, rug fringe, or furniture.
According to the model, you can schedule a robot vacuum to run several times per day or even observe it in action with an app. However, these handy vacuums are also prone to clogging and require frequent maintenance, such as emptying the bin onboard (or the base's larger dust bin in some instances) as well as checking the brushes for tangled hair, and periodically rinsing and allowing the filters to dry as suggested by the manufacturer.
Emily Rairdin is a vacuum expert and store owner apprentice at University Vacuum + Sewing. She believes that a robotic vacuum can last from three to five years with proper maintenance. She recommends regularly emptying the bin and brush roll and cutting off any hair that has gotten caught in the brushes, and regularly washing and drying the filter if your robot also acts as mop. It's also recommended to wipe down the sensors and charging contacts on the dock or robot often with a soft, clean cloth. Then, recharge and refill the robot as needed for the next time you clean.
